The original Nike Sky Force debuted in 1984 and served as a predecessor to a number of well known basketball-turned lifestyle kicks of today such as the Nike Dunk and Nike Terminator. In 1988, the Nike Sky Force returned in a Low and High version, featuring leather uppers and a re-designed construction with a toebox similar to the Nike Court Force of 1987. Arriving in Spring 2011 is the Nike Sky Force Retro with a vintage pre-yellowed treatment on the midsole and distressed leather material. Everything about this shoe screams ’80’s’, like the flat-footed traction, gaudy branding on the tongue, and as the ribbed corduroy-like ankle liner that was also used in later Nike Basketball releases at the turn of the decade.
